Psalms 42:1As the hart panteth after the water brooks, So panteth my soul after thee, O God. <To the chief music-maker. Maschil. Of the sons of Korah.> Like the desire of the roe for the water-streams, so is my soul's desire for you, O God.To the Overseer. An Instruction. By sons of Korah. As a hart doth pant for streams of water, So my soul panteth toward Thee, O God.As the hart panteth after the water brooks, so panteth my soul after thee, O God.
Psalms 42:2My soul thirsteth for God, for the living God: When shall I come and appear before God? My soul is dry for need of God, the living God; when may I come and see the face of God?My soul thirsted for God, for the living God, When do I enter and see the face of God?My soul thirsteth for God, for the living God: when shall I come and appear before God?
Psalms 42:3My tears have been my food day and night, While they continually say unto me, Where is thy God? My tears have been my food day and night, while they keep saying to me, Where is your God?My tear hath been to me bread day and night, In their saying unto me all the day, `Where [is] thy God?`My tears have been my meat day and night, while they continually say unto me, Where is thy God?
Psalms 42:4These things I remember, and pour out my soul within me, How I went with the throng, and led them to the house of God, With the voice of joy and praise, a multitude keeping holyday. Let my soul be overflowing with grief when these things come back to my mind, how I went in company to the house of God, with the voice of joy and praise, with the song of those who were keeping the feast.These I remember, and pour out my soul in me, For I pass over into the booth, I go softly with them unto the house of God, With the voice of singing and confession, The multitude keeping feast!When I remember these things, I pour out my soul in me: for I had gone with the multitude, I went with them to the house of God, with the voice of joy and praise, with a multitude that kept holyday.
Psalms 42:5Why art thou cast down, O my soul? And [why] art thou disquieted within me? Hope thou in God; for I shall yet praise him [For] the help of his countenance. Why are you crushed down, O my soul? and why are you troubled in me? put your hope in God; for I will again give him praise who is my help and my God.What! bowest thou thyself, O my soul? Yea, art thou troubled within me? Wait for God, for still I confess Him: The salvation of my countenance My God!Why art thou cast down, O my soul? and why art thou disquieted in me? hope thou in God: for I shall yet praise him for the help of his countenance.
Psalms 42:6O my God, my soul is cast down within me: Therefore do I remember thee from the land of the Jordan, And the Hermons, from the hill Mizar. My soul is crushed down in me, so I will keep you in mind; from the land of Jordan and of the Hermons, from the hill Mizar.In me doth my soul bow itself, Therefore I remember Thee from the land of Jordan, And of the Hermons, from the hill Mizar.O my God, my soul is cast down within me: therefore will I remember thee from the land of Jordan, and of the Hermonites, from the hill Mizar.
Psalms 42:7Deep calleth unto deep at the noise of thy waterfalls: All thy waves and thy billows are gone over me. Deep is sounding to deep at the noise of your waterfalls; all your waves have gone rolling over me.Deep unto deep is calling At the noise of Thy water-spouts, All Thy breakers and Thy billows passed over me.Deep calleth unto deep at the noise of thy waterspouts: all thy waves and thy billows are gone over me.
Psalms 42:8[Yet] Jehovah will command his lovingkindness in the day-time; And in the night his song shall be with me, [Even] a prayer unto the God of my life. But the Lord will send his mercy in the daytime, and in the night his song will be with me, a prayer to the God of my life.By day Jehovah commandeth His kindness, And by night a song [is] with me, A prayer to the God of my life.Yet the LORD will command his lovingkindness in the daytime, and in the night his song shall be with me, and my prayer unto the God of my life.
Psalms 42:9I will say unto God my rock, Why hast thou forgotten me? Why go I mourning because of the oppression of the enemy? I will say to God my Rock, Why have you let me go from your memory? why do I go in sorrow because of the attacks of my haters?I say to God my rock, `Why hast Thou forgotten me? Why go I mourning in the oppression of an enemy?I will say unto God my rock, Why hast thou forgotten me? why go I mourning because of the oppression of the enemy?
Psalms 42:10As with a sword in my bones, mine adversaries reproach me, While they continually say unto me, Where is thy God? The cruel words of my haters are like a crushing of my bones; when they say to me every day, Where is your God?With a sword in my bones Have mine adversaries reproached me, In their saying unto me all the day, `Where [is] thy God?`As with a sword in my bones, mine enemies reproach me; while they say daily unto me, Where is thy God?
Psalms 42:11Why art thou cast down, O my soul? And why art thou disquieted within me? Hope thou in God; for I shall yet praise him, [Who is] the help of my countenance, and my God. Psalm 43 Why are you crushed down, O my soul? and why are you troubled in me? put your hope in God; for I will again give him praise who is my help and my God.What! bowest thou thyself, O my soul? And what! art thou troubled within me? Wait for God, for still I confess Him, The salvation of my countenance, and my God!Why art thou cast down, O my soul? and why art thou disquieted within me? hope thou in God: for I shall yet praise him, who is the health of my countenance, and my God.
